jQuery-UI 또는 부트스트랩에서 지원하는 시간 플러그인 datepicker는 프런트엔드 개발에 많이 사용됩니다. 이 장에서는 시간 플러그인 datepicker와 jquery-steps 간의 충돌을 해결하는 방법을 소개합니다. 도움이 필요한 친구들이 참고할 수 있기를 바랍니다.
Date 플러그인 초기화: $('.prelease_time').Flatpickr();
let contentSteps = $("#content_form").steps({ headerTag: "h3", bodyTag: "section", transitionEffect: "slideLeft", enableAllSteps: true, enablePagination: true, onStepChanging: function(event, currentIndex, newIndex) { console.log(11) return true; }, onStepChanged: function(event, currentIndex, priorIndex) { console.log(22) return false; }, onFinishing: function(event, currentIndex) { console.log(33) return true; }, onFinished: function(event, currentIndex) { console.log(44) return false; } });
렌더링 순서가 다릅니다. 예를 들어 jquery-steps는 이때 DOM을 다시 렌더링해야 합니다. 날짜 선택기를 다시 초기화하세요
위 내용은 시간 플러그인 datepicker(jQuery-UI, bootstrap)와 jquery-steps 간의 충돌을 해결하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!